Irish auctioneers Sheppard's of Durrow are likely to be propelled into TV stardom thanks to the Country House Auction, a series of four one-hour programmes on Channel 4. The show, which is about to be broadcast, captures all the suspense and excitement of a live sale Sheppards conducted at Castle Durrow early last November.
While Sheppard's, Durrow and its castle are the stars of the show a sacred Tibetan meteorite iron Phurba, which made €140,000 at hammer over an estimate of €20,000-€30,000, is the star of the auction and the opening episode.
